what makes Obento Cracked Black Pepper Ramen Noodle Bowl 240g different
Obento Cracked Black Pepper Ramen Noodle Bowl is a spicy pepper flavored ramen noodles with black pepper topping. Packed conveniently into a bowl so that this delicious Black Pepper Ramen noodle is quick and easy to prepare, ideal for a simple on-the-go meal. Cracked Black Pepper Ramen Noodle is ready just in 2 minutes in microwaveable. Preparation: 1. Remove contents from bowl. 2. Place 4 tablespoons of water and dehydrated vegetables in bowl. 3. Add noodles, sauce and sesame seeds, cover loosely with lid. Microwave on high for approximately 2 minutes. 4. Stir through until evenly mixed.
Ingredients
Pasta (78%): water, wheat flour, sunflower oil, gluten, salt, acidity regulator (E270). Pepper sauce (20%): water, mushroom slices, soy sauce (water, salt, soy, wheat), cane sugar, fresh onions, mirin, Soyaoil, tomato paste, salt, fresh garlic, spices, yeast extract, flavor enhancers (E621, E635), thickeners (E1422, E415), emulsifier (E452), acidity regulator (E330), preservative (E211). Dehydrated vegetables: carrots, peppers, green onions. Topping: salt, ground black pepper, flavor enhancer (E621), white pepper powder, glucose, spices, anti-caking agent (E551).

Cup Noodles in Korea und Japan
Loved by Koreans and all around world! Ramen, which is a perfect combination with Kimchi and Korean radishes, can be easily cooked by anyone. Cup noodles are by far the most popular item in Japanese convenience stores! There are even many tourists who buy cup noodles as a souvenir in Japan. Instant noodles are made with noodles boiled once and fried for cooking later time. Nowadays, instant noodles, loved by both Korea and Japan, are said to be invented by Ando Momofuku, a Taiwanese Japanese in Japan after the end of World War II. At that time, there was a lot of wheat flour as a relief item from the US Army. The first instant noodles were chicken ramen noodles made on the island of Shinshu Shokusan, the predecessor of the Nissin food industry.
